A golf-focused itinerary through England's premier clubs, from Sunningdale near London to the stacked links courses of the Kent coast.
Sights & activities
- Sunningdale Golf Club: 36-hole private club ranked top 50 in the world. Both courses are world-class. £400 per course. Described as the closest experience to Pine Valley. Private clubs are open to the public on weekdays in the UK. Located 20 minutes from a London airport. reel
- Royal St. George’s: Ranked #33 in the world. Located on the Kent coast, 2 hours southeast of Sunningdale. £350 per round. Features exceptional par threes and pot bunkers; wind can be challenging. reel
